Hello everyone,
I am new to this forum and was hoping to get some advice from those who have been through (or are currently going through) the process of Administrative Processing on a K-1 Visa.
I am the US Citizen Sponsor and my fiancé is the beneficiary in Egypt.
Here is our timeline:
2/20/19 - My fiancé completes interview in Cairo. APPROVED, and given letter saying "Congratulations, you are approved and will receive passport in 2 weeks" They kept my fiancé's passport and did fingerprints and kept all documents (medical, police certificate, etc).
2/20/19 - Case is in Administrative Processing until 3/5/19
3/5/19 - My fiancé receives an email requesting that additional information be provided. (Travel History, Names of Brothers/Sisters, Work History, Social Media, Residence)
As of today (4/5/19) it is still in Administrative Processing. We know that it can usually take up to 60 days for finalizing, and there are no issues because my fiancé has never been married, no children, has never traveled anywhere, has lived in the same home for over 10 years, and has only had one place of employment. My fiancé does have a family name that is very common in Egypt, so we are thinking this may be the reason (and of course the standard security checks they need to do).
